C1 Inhibitor Deficient Products
C1 Inhibitor Genetically Deficient (Knockout) Products are applicable to a wide range of in vitro research applications (including ELISA and Western Blot) and for many different areas of research, including hemorrhagic shock, septic shock, transplant rejection, reperfusion injury, inflammatory disorders, and hereditary angioedema.
Our off-the-shelf C1 Inhibitor Knockout Mouse products are available from Homozygous Knockout Mice. Our C1 Inhibitor Homozygous Knockout was created by targeted excision of the SERPING1 gene, and these mice completely lack C1 Inhibitor protein expression.
Products available include genetically deficient plasma, organs (flash-frozen), lyophilized organ powders, and ready-to-use organ tissue lysates. These products are ideal for use as standards or controls, including use as a negative control.
Additionally, we offer Knockout Mice in individual male and/or female mice as well as breeding pairs. Our C1 Inhibitor Knockout models are available in homozygous form, as well as heterozygous mice that function as an animal model of human Hereditary Angioedema (HAE).
